Sustainable Mineral Acquisition in the Continent – A Increasing Necessity
Increasingly need exists for firms to guarantee the responsible origin of minerals extracted in the Region. Historically , exploitation has often been connected to human rights abuses and environmental degradation , making traceability a vital concern . The public are expecting greater awareness into the value networks and a pledge to equitable treatment and environmental protection . Consequently , responsible mineral supply is no longer a luxury , but a key corporate duty and a vital step towards lasting success for all stakeholders .
Industrial Commodity Exporters: Challenges and Opportunities in Africa
African nations face a difficult landscape as primary commodity exporters . While possessing vast resources – ranging minerals, cultivated products, and energy sources – they are often confronted with substantial hurdles. These involve price fluctuations , infrastructure gaps, constrained diversification of financial sectors, and the effect of global trade policies.
- Challenge: Price swings affecting revenue.
- Challenge: Poor infrastructure hindering transport .
- Opportunity: Value-added processing creating jobs.
- Opportunity: Intra-African trade boosting growth.
